How can I use a wildcard with the Keyword Search?

The Keyword Search supports single and multiple character wildcard searches.


To perform a multiple character wildcard search, use the "*" symbol. Multiple character wildcard searches looks for 0 or more characters. For example:


To perform a single character wildcard search, use the "?" symbol. The single character wildcard search looks for items that match with the single character replaced. For example:


Note: You cannot use a * or ? symbol as the first character of a search.

In what order are my search results displayed?

If you use the "Subject Search" tab in the Course Catalog, courses are sorted in alphanumeric order by course code. First-year courses are located at the top of the list, followed by second-year courses, and so on, unless additional filters are applied using the filters on the left-hand side of your screen.

If you use the "Search for courses" box at the top right-hand side of your screen, courses are displayed based on relevance to your search terms. Courses are not listed according to course code or year. If you only want to view courses for a specific year, use the filters on the left-hand side of your screen.

How can I view a table listing of sections?

In the advanced search tab, you will see a Results View option. Click the Section Listing option to return a table view of sections instead of the full course catalog results. You can add a section directly to your schedule from the Section Listing view.

Why is course section information (e.g., seat availability, meeting information, etc.) different when selecting Section Listing in the Advanced Search compared to Catalog Listing?

Information on the Section Listing page is only updated once a day (overnight), so you will not see changes until the next day. Use the Basic Search or the Catalog Listing view in the Advanced Search to view the most up-to-date course section information.

I’m interested in taking a certain course through Distance Education (DE), and the course description indicates that the course is offered in a DE format. The course offerings for the semester are now posted, and the course is only being offered through face-to-face delivery. Why isn’t it being offered in a DE format as indicated in the course description?

Information in the course description about when and how a course is offered should only be used as a guide. If the “Offering(s)” section of the course description indicates “Also offered through Distance Education format,” this may not apply to all semesters, and the course may only be available through face-to-face delivery in some semesters. If you would like to know more about when the course is usually offered through DE, please contact the department that organizes the course. The department is indicated in the course description.
